    In Massachusetts, an enterprising entrepreneur has opened a store called "Let's Go Brandon." The North Attleborough store "sells merchandise like hats, shirts, stickers and signs," as WJAR reports.

    The ubiquitous "Let's Go Brandon" meme was triggered in early October, when an NBC sports reporter interviewing NASCAR driver Brandon Brown at Talladega Superspeedway in Alabama after Brown scored his first career NASCAR Xfinity Series win stated in a video that the crowd was chanting "Let's go, Brandon!" when in reality they were chanting "F*** Joe Biden."

    The meme grew even more in subsequent days; in mid-October, asked by an announcer to "help kick this thing off" at the NAPA Super DIRT Week Pro Stock 50 event at Oswego Speedway on Sunday, one young boy, who was asked along with another young boy and young girl, continued after the three intoned "Drivers, start your engines" by asserting, "Let's Go, Brandon."

    Roughly a week and a half later, Texas GOP Attorney General Ken Paxton announced that his state would join Missouri to file suit against the Biden administration, telling the cheering crowd that he wanted to say to President Joe Biden, "Let's go, Brandon! We'll see you in court."
